About Jhālrapātan Time Zone

Jhālrapātan, India uses Asia/Kolkata, the standard time zone for most of India. The city follows UTC+5:30 all year, which means its clock stays on the same offset throughout the year without seasonal clock changes.

Jhālrapātan, India does not observe daylight saving time, so its local time remains stable for scheduling across months. That consistency is valuable for manufacturing, trading, customer support, and software teams that need a fixed reference point when coordinating with cities that do change clocks seasonally, such as New York, London, and Sydney.

In regional terms, Jhālrapātan, India sits in Rajasthan, where business coordination often connects to other Indian commercial centers as well as international hubs through Delhi, Mumbai, and Jaipur. Because India keeps a single national time zone, Jhālrapātan, India shares the same local time behavior as other major Indian cities, which simplifies domestic planning even when travel spans long distances.

Time Differences from Jhālrapātan

Jhālrapātan, India is a useful reference point for global scheduling because its offset stays fixed at UTC+5:30 all year. That makes it easier to compare against cities where the offset changes by season, especially for teams working across the US, UK, Australia, and the Middle East.

In January,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 10 hours 30 minutes ahead of New York (UTC-5):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 10:30 PM the previous day in New York. In July,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 9 hours 30 minutes ahead of New York (UTC-4):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 11:30 PM the previous day in New York. That gap is important for US client calls, because a morning slot in Rajasthan usually lands late at night in New York.

In January,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 5 hours 30 minutes ahead of London (UTC+0):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 3:30 AM in London. In July,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 4 hours 30 minutes ahead of London (UTC+1):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 4:30 AM in London. For UK-based partners, this usually means late afternoon in Jhālrapātan, India is the more practical window for live discussions.

In January,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 3 hours 30 minutes behind Tokyo (UTC+9):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 12:30 PM in Tokyo. In July,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 3 hours 30 minutes behind Tokyo (UTC+9):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 12:30 PM in Tokyo. This steady gap makes India–Japan coordination simpler for product teams, manufacturing workflows, and support handoffs.

In January,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 5 hours 30 minutes behind Sydney (UTC+11):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 2:30 PM in Sydney. In July,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 4 hours 30 minutes behind Sydney (UTC+10):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 1:30 PM in Sydney. This matters for Australia-facing operations, where a Jhālrapātan, India morning can still fit into the Australian workday.

In January,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 1 hour 30 minutes ahead of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 7:30 AM in Dubai. In July, Jhālrapātan, India (UTC+5:30) is 1 hour 30 minutes ahead of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in Jhālrapātan, India, it is 7:30 AM in Dubai. That small difference is useful for trade, logistics, and Gulf-region coordination because the overlap is broad enough for early-day business calls.
